Safaree Samuels was short-lived because the reality TV star has revealed that she’s raising their child alone, and is expected to do the same with the baby she’s currently carrying.
TMZ reports that on Friday, Mena filed for divorce after less than 2 years of marriage.
According to the outlet, “Erica is asking for primary physical custody of their 1-year-old daughter,
Safire, but she’s willing to share joint legal custody with Safaree. She’s also indicated she wants child support, plus … exclusive use of the home they currently share,” TMZ writes.
Earlier this month, Safaree and his estranged wife announced that they are expecting baby #2! The “Love & Hip Hop” stars shared the exciting news via an Instagram post showing off Mena’s baby bump.

In a time when falling in love with a married man or – shock! – someone of the same sex was taboo, many chose to live a lie rather than risk the shame it would unleash. So for these women, uncovering long buried truths was devastating
‘Mum wrote, “I don’t understand why I’m different”’
Helen Garlick, 62, is a former divorce mediator from West Sussex
Growing up in 1960s Yorkshire, I always thought my parents looked like the ideal couple. Their 59 years together showed how well suited they were, sharing the same aims and values and relishing their role as staunch pillars of the community. It was a conventional postwar childhood: my father Geoffrey would work hard in his own legal practice to provide for us, while my mother Monica ran the home with flair as well as volunteering in the community.
